A Laurel Heights Holiday Novelette

Trudy Hawke's mission: to go on vacation and have fun.

A prison sentence, more like it. She doesn't take vacations, and she especially doesn't go anywhere during the holidays. But her boss insists it's the price she needs to pay to become a full partner in his new private investigation firm. She'll do anything to become partner--even subject herself to love, peace, and Christmas music.

Trudy figures it's no big deal: she'll hole up in a hotel in Laurel Heights, drink gin, and watch action movies until she can return to London. Only her tyrant boss gives her a holiday list of to-do items, for which she must email picture proof of completion.

It's impossible... Until she meets Mason, who proposes a deal: he'll help her with the list if she's his date to his office holiday events, to show his edgy tech employees that he's more than a nerd from Iowa. From the moment she agrees, Trudy gets more than she bargained for, but she refuses to be corrupted by the magic of the season--or love.

Funny, modern fast romance

Trudy finds herself on a vacation that she didn't want to take. Her boss tells her she has to go on holiday and relax, or he will not consider making her a partner in the investigation firm. He even makes a list of things she has to do and then send pictures to him to prove she is having a good time! She meets Mason, who trades with her - she helps him, he helps her, they both win!

The rest of the story is punctuated with text messages which discuss the "game" between Trudy, Mason and Trudy's boss. Romance blossoms amid the fun and games as the unlikely pair work on their checklists to improve their job, only to improve and change their lives forever.

Happy ending, stand-alone book - great quick read. Looking forward to the next book in the series.

Originally reviewed at Keeper Bookshelf

Trudy is on the enforced vacation from hell. She doesn’t want to be on vacation. She hates vacations. She’d much rather be online, watching action movies or… just about anything that does not even remotely involve a vacation – Christmas vacations no less. One where she has to document “Having Fun” for her boss back home in order to get that partnership she wants. If only pulling out purple streaked hair would help, Trudy would be doing that too. But nothing was going to help. Not even the handsome man who keeps watching her from across the cafe.

Mason is captivated by the lovely, blue striped hair woman across the cafe. (Mason is color blind). She is as nonconformist a woman as he’s ever seen in Laurel Heights, and he knows a lot of people here. There’s simply something about her that draws him. And he’s going to find out exactly what that is. The dagger looks she’s sending his way don’t really count – she doesn’t-know that the lady he’s buying coffee for is a friend so he gives her points for not liking a cheating kinda man. And once he realizes that she’s gotta document having fun for Christmas – he offers up a deal, one that benefits them both.

I have absolutely no intention of giving anything more away about Wrapped In You. This is a one of a kind, laugh out loud and simply feel good kinda story that no one should ruin for you by saying too much. Trudy is delightful in her own unique way. Mason is dashing as a hero who simply wants to enjoy this woman exactly as she is – he wouldn’t change one thing… except maybe make her his on a long time permanent kinda deal.

Fall in love right along with Trudy and Mason. This is probably one you’re going to want to pick up again next year. It will make you feel that good. If you love Christmas romance, then this is perfect for you.
